1. The Genuine Burberry Label:
The label itself is a crucial element in verifying authenticity. Genuine Burberry labels are meticulously crafted, using high-quality materials and precise stitching. Look for:
* Consistent Font and Logo: The Burberry logo and font should be perfectly rendered, with no inconsistencies or blurring. Counterfeit labels often exhibit slight variations in font style, logo proportions, or overall design.
* Material Quality: Genuine labels are usually made from high-quality materials that feel luxurious to the touch. Cheap, flimsy materials are a strong indicator of a fake.
* Stitching Quality: The stitching on a genuine Burberry label is impeccable, with even, consistent stitches. Uneven or loose stitching is a clear sign of a counterfeit.
* Placement and Alignment: The label's placement on the shoe should be precise and aligned correctly. Misaligned or awkwardly placed labels are often characteristic of fakes.
* Language and Information: Genuine labels will include accurate information, including the brand name, size, material composition, and country of origin. Inconsistent or missing information suggests a counterfeit.
